Why is tungsten a refractory metal?
From an atomic structure point of view, the atomic structure of tungsten is closer than that of other metals, with higher atomic number, atomic radius and atomic bonds. These properties make the bond between tungsten atoms stronger, requiring higher energy to separate the tungsten atoms from each other, thus melting the tungsten.

From the perspective of melting point and thermal stability, tungsten has a high melting point and thermal stability, so it is not easy to melt, oxidize or evaporate even at very high temperatures. It is worth mentioning that the boiling point of tungsten is about 5660°C, the heat of fusion is about 35.3kJ/mol, and the heat of vaporization is about 806.7kJ/mol.
